    @Mwangi
    Windows Live Writer is a Blogging Software that enables you compose your posts offline and then send them straight to your blog when you connect to the internet. It is beneficial for bloggers that do not have high connection speed or pay heavily for time spent online. I hope this answer the question.

    I had no trouble downloading and installing Live Writer. It’s a very cool tool that I use to compose many of my posts.

    One drawback is that if you have such plugins as SEO on your WordPress blog, you still have to go to the blog to make that happen.

    I do like the way it handles pictures — much easier than doing putting them in wordpress.
